Healthy Carrot Cake Protein Muffins

Soft, fluffy, and naturally sweet, these Carrot Cake Protein Muffins are a delicious way to enjoy a nutritious treat. Made with wholesome oats, fresh carrots, and protein-rich cottage cheese, they’re ideal for breakfast, post-workout snacks, or easy meal prep throughout the week.

Ingredients

  • 1 cup cottage cheese (blended until creamy)
  • 2 large eggs
  • 2 cups rolled oats, ground into oat flour
  • 1½ cups freshly grated carrots
  • 2 tablespoons honey or maple syrup
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• ¼ teaspoon salt
  • ¼ cup chopped walnuts

Directions

1. Prepare the Oven

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Line a 12-cup muffin pan with paper liners or lightly grease each cup.

2. Mix the Wet Ingredients

In a mixing bowl, combine the smooth cottage cheese, eggs, honey (or maple syrup), and vanilla extract. Whisk until the mixture is creamy and well blended.

3. Add the Dry Ingredients

Stir in the oat flour, cinnamon, baking powder, and salt until a soft batter forms.

4. Fold in the Carrots and Walnuts

Gently mix in the grated carrots and chopped walnuts, making sure they are evenly distributed.

5. Fill the Muffin Cups

Spoon the batter into the prepared muffin pan, filling each cup about ¾ full.

6. Bake

Bake for 18 to 22 minutes, or until the tops are golden and a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

7. Cool and Enjoy

Allow the muffins to cool in the pan for about 5 minutes, then transfer them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Tip

Store them in an airtight container for up to 4 days, or freeze them for a quick grab-and-go snack anytime.
